...The National Weather Service in Indianapolis IN has issued a
Flood Warning for the following rivers in Indiana...
Mill Creek near Cataract.
.Between 2 and 4 inches of rain have fallen across central Indiana
as of early Wednesday morning. Up to 2 inches have fallen in
south-central Indiana. This has led creeks to rise above flood stage
and rivers will follow in the coming days. Additional rain is in the
forecast over the next several days.
* WHAT...Minor flooding is forecast.
* WHERE...Mill Creek near Cataract.
* WHEN...From early this morning to this evening.
* IMPACTS...At 15.0 feet, Mill Creek at flood stage. Camp Otto Road
begins to flood. Low pasture land along Mill Creek begins to
flood.
*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...
- At 5:15 AM EST Wednesday the stage was 14.9 feet.
- Forecast...The river is expected to rise to a crest of 15.4
feet late this morning. It will then fall below flood stage
this afternoon.
- Flood stage is 15.0 feet.
